| Requirement | Enterprise | SME |
|---|---|---|
| Implementation timeline | 3–12 months acceptable | Must be live in 30–60 days |
| IT resources | Dedicated IT team | Maintenance manager runs it |
| Analysis capability | In-house analytics team | AI must do the analysis automatically |
| Technician training | Formal programs, weeks | Must adopt in days without formal training |
| Year-one budget | $200K+ acceptable | Under $80K required |
| Multi-site governance | Critical requirement | Usually single site, not needed |
